Authors: Vladimir Kublanov and Anna Petrenko

Affiliation: Ural Federal University, Russian Federation

Keyword(s): Neuroscience of Learning, Neuro-electrostimulation, Neuroplasticity, Learning Ability, Attention, Working Memory.

Abstract: The paper describes the results of using the neuro-electrostimulation device for improving the attention and working memory characteristics, which are one of the main parameters of cognition in the learning process. It was shown that the quality of the test for assessment of working memory and attention in the experimental group with the use of neuro-electrostimulation was higher than in the control group. Also it was found that the application of neuro-electrostimulation could be used as a corrective technique for subjects with low initial values of test parameters, which allows increasing the test results for assessing working memory and attention.
